dc.description.abstractBACKGROUND: We observed that few research studies have also examined radiation safety awareness among healthcare professionals in Asia-Pacific countries. One such study, conducted among medical and dental practitioners in India found comparatively poor awareness about radiation hazards. Hence, the present study was conducted to understand the radiation awareness among consultants and postgraduates of KLE hospital and also to understand the need for improving the awareness.en_US
